				Overview:

The Program Director ‐ Finance/Productivity is responsible for all aspects of benchmarking and productivity for Confluence Health including maintenance of the System's productivity solutions, utilizing standard productivity benchmarks based on National guidelines, ensuring integrity of productivity data across all solutions, producing actionable and timely productivity reporting, and identification of productivity opportunities and solutions.

Position Reports To: Chief Financial Officer

Responsibilities:

* Supports the VP‐Finance and Senior Leadership Team (SLT) members in developing and implementing productivity strategies that support the safe, efficient, and effective operation of departments and programs as well as producing and maintaining measurable financial improvements.
* Maintains the System's productivity solutions including data integrity, benchmarking, productivity monitoring, tracking, and reporting systems.
* Utilizes data analysis software and/or other relevant methods to access/extract data in relational databases and maintain technical expertise.
* Provides key analysis and evaluation of performance to support operations and improvement and other performance management efforts.
* Works directly with the regional finance teams to identify opportunities and develop operational procedures that support the System's productivity strategies.
* Coordinates with the regional finance teams, create and implement processes, tools, productivity and staffing education, training and resources that enable department leaders and teams to understand and interpret data and use the tools to improve productivity.
* Understands and apply industry best practices, standards, and regulations related to productivity tools, financial analysis, auditing, and reporting.
* Utilizes tools, resources and benchmarks that consider the variety of production‐based operations/staff that exist across the System like research, health plan, care delivery, acute, ambulatory, etc. and recognize the need for minimum administrative staffing.
* Understands, presents and explains complex financial, clinical and productivity data in a clear and understandable manner.
* Participates on appropriate committees, teams, and meetings to provide regular metrics on productivity, staffing grids, productivity opportunities and proposed solutions.
* Performs timely and accurate benchmarking audits, data submission, report generation and associated leader education regarding report interpretation and improvement opportunity identification.
* Ensures consistency between the productivity solutions and the labor budget process and develop productivity targets.
